NewsPS Vita App Walkthrough part 2
We get our hands on the first edition bundle of the PS Vita, and walk you through its contents, as well as some of the PS Vita installed Applications.
We take a look at the included Web Browser, which isn't the best of web browsers around, and is quite similar to the one found on the PSP.
Then we take the Photo app for a spin, which is surprisingly good, albeit not a very high quality. It also takes video with a press of a button.
The video app houses all rented or bought and downloaded videos from the PS Store. The movies can either be rented for $3.99 or bought for $14.99 though there are specials in the store which make some rentals cheaper.
